Collimator

A spectrometer component consisting of a slit and a convex lens with the slit in its focal plane that converts light diverging from a source into parallel rays.

Diffraction Grating

A piece of glass with a very large number of ruled lines that separates light into its component colors through interference.

Telescope

A spectrometer component used to observe the image of the slit after light from the source has passed through the diffraction grating.

Grating Spacing (aa)

The distance between adjacent ruled lines on a diffraction grating, given by the inverse of the number of lines per unit length (a=1na = \frac{1}{n}).

Order Number (mm)

An integer value (m=0,1,2,m = 0, 1, 2, \dots) in the grating formula asin(θ)=mλa \sin(\theta) = m \lambda representing the order of constructive interference.

Goniometer

A built-in device on the spectrometer used to measure the angular position of each emission line viewed through the telescope.

Reticle

A set of cross-hairs intersecting in the center of the field-of-view that permits precise alignment of the telescope with an emission line.

Central Angle (θ0\theta_0)

The angular position of the direct beam or zeroth-order image (m=0m = 0), used to calculate relative angular displacements of higher-order lines.

Diffraction Pattern Formula

The formula asin(θ)=mλa \sin(\theta) = m \lambda describing constructive interference through multiple slits, where aa is grating spacing, θ\theta is the angle from the normal, mm is the order number, and λ\lambda is the wavelength.

Vernier Scale

A scale on the goniometer that enables determination of angular measurements to an accuracy of 0.10.1^\circ.

Prism

A wedge of glass that refracts white light and disperses it into its component colors.

Angular Displacement

The absolute value of the angular separation between the absolute angular position of an emission line and the central angle (θ0\theta_0).

Sodium Yellow Lines

Two closely spaced yellow emission lines emitted by a Sodium source with wavelengths λ1=589.0nm\lambda_1 = 589.0\,nm and λ2=589.6nm\lambda_2 = 589.6\,nm.
